Transparency International, an international corruption watchdog, has named India the most corrupt country in Asia.
According to a foreign news agency, Transparency International said in its report that India has the highest corruption rate in Asia at 39%.
According to the report, 46% of Indians pay bribes to work in government agencies, which is the highest rate in Asia. The bribe-givers told Transparency International that there is no work done in India without having to bribe for it.
According to Transparency International, 20,000 people from 17 Asian countries were surveyed. Japan and the Maldives are among the countries with the lowest levels of bribery.
The report states “Nearly 50% of those who paid bribes were asked to, while 32% of those who used personal connections said they would not receive the service otherwise.”
